SMITH, Mr. Roger Ellis Sr. age 59 of Dayton, Ohio passed away Saturday, July 25, 2009 at the Pinnacle Pointe Nursing & Rehabilitation Center after a lengthy illness. He was a native of Mansfield, Ohio, for 32 years and had resided in Dayton for 27 years. Roger was employed by Plating Technology, Inc. He was preceded in death by his parents, Fell Smith Jr., and Mary Alice (Brooks) and his brother Charles Michael Fletcher. Survivors include his wife, Ezell Smith, of Dayton; daughters, Melissa (Jackie) Williams of Mansfield, Natalie Walker, Renee and April Craver of Dayton; sons, Roger Ellis Smith Jr., Thomas Michael Smith, Anthony and Jeffrey Carver of Dayton; two sisters Lesia Payton (Clifton) Columbus, and Regina Dixon (Rafael) of Mansfield; two step-sisters, three step-brothers, and a aunt Mrs. Mary Frances Caldwell, (22) grandchildren & one great-grandchild and a host of nieces, nephews cousins and friends. Visitation at 11:00 with funeral services starting at 12:00 noon Friday, July 31, 2009 at the Gods Way Triune Ministries, 4544 Old Troy Pike, with Rev. Jim Holmes, and Michael J. Miles II, officiating. Interment Jeffersonview Cemetery, with arrangements entrusted to the LORITTS-NEILSON FUNERAL HOME, INC., 3924 W. Third St. Procession will leave from 3319 Shiloh Springs Rd. at 10:15 a.m.
